#USStablecoinBill The U.S. Senate's proposed stablecoin legislation has ignited intense debate, reflecting the complexities of regulating digital assets. While the bill aims to establish a clear framework—mandating full reserve backing, stringent compliance with anti-money laundering laws, and oversight by federal regulators like the Federal Reserve and OCC—concerns have emerged. Notably, nine Senate Democrats have withdrawn support, citing insufficient measures against money laundering and potential risks to financial stability . Additionally, the bill's exemption for major foreign issuers like Tether raises questions about equitable regulation . The controversy is further fueled by a $2 billion investment involving a Trump-affiliated stablecoin, USD1, and Binance, highlighting the intersection of politics and crypto .
